Transaction 9ed2863bd04038f23f694bfc2111c1439b2478539e997bba987106743400c599
1 Input
2 Outputs
- 9ed2863bd04038f23f694bfc2111c1439b2478539e997bba987106743400c599:0
- 9ed2863bd04038f23f694bfc2111c1439b2478539e997bba987106743400c599:1
value 839185
address 1DvyECfA6mXwxkmJ12BnbBnqozpLKqqurT
value 2514183
address 12FgEWYHzqodEoGscM3v8wmAsmL1dbovKu